Army of Two: The 40th Day To Drop in January

Submitted by on August 13, 2009 – 10:34 am2 Comments

armyoflove

Salem and Rios, stars of the co-op action title, Army of Two, will be returning in January in the sequel, Army of Two: The 40th Day.  The title is scheduled for a January 8th, 2010 release in Europe, while hitting North American shores on January 12th, 2010.

This release date seats the Army of Two sequel in a lot of post holiday traffic, which is unusual for that time of year.  It will be interesting to see how this title fares with the additional competition, and if the issues from the first title were fixed.

Army of Two: The 40th Day takes place in the middle of Shanghai, China, during what appears to be a massive military event, possibly a coup of the standing government.  Our two buddies, Salen and Rios, seem to be caught behind enemy lines during a mercenary mission that they were on in the same province.  We will probably find out more as we get closer to launch.

EA Montreal Announces ARMY OF TWO: THE 40th DAY Will Hit Retail Stores in January 2010

Exclusive Access to All-New Multi-Player Mode ‘Extraction’ Available with Pre-Order

 MONTREAL, Aug 13, 2009 (BUSINESS WIRE) — Start off 2010 with a bang! EA Montreal, a studio of Electronic Arts Inc. (NASDAQ:ERTS), today announced ARMY OF TWO(TM): THE 40th DAY will ship on January 12, 2010 in North America and January 8, 2010 in Europe. The sequel to the 2008 multi-platinum co-op shooter sees the return of the ultimate two-man private military team, Salem and Rios. Trapped in the middle of Shanghai as it falls under attack, the two must work as a team to survive relentless enemy assaults and escape the city collapsing around them. Gamers who pre-order* ARMY OF TWO: THE 40th DAY now will have exclusive access to the game’s all-new explosive multi-player mode, ‘Extraction,’ at launch. This mode will be unlocked for all other players one month after the game ships.

ARMY OF TWO: THE 40th DAY features a more robust and redesigned multiplayer experience with four unique multiplayer modes including ‘Extraction’. ‘Extraction’ pits a team of four players against a series of unique enemy waves as they move from point to point in the ruined city. Players must strategize as a unified team to combat the different forces of the 40th Day Initiative while trying to get out alive.

In ARMY OF TWO: THE 40th DAY, private military contractors, Salem and Rios must fight their way through Shanghai to survive a carefully orchestrated series of catastrophes that are dragging the massive city to the brink of ruin. Jonah, the mastermind behind the 40th Day Initiative, has amassed an army of skilled soldiers to level the city in his attempt to rebuild an empire according to his vision and ideals. Now, the Army of Two must fight their way through ravaged city districts as they try to beat the odds.

ARMY OF TWO: THE 40th DAY will be available for the Xbox 360(R) videogame and entertainment system, the PLAYSTATION(R)3 computer entertainment system and the PSP(R) (PlayStation(R) Portable).

About Electronic Arts

Electronic Arts Inc. (EA), headquartered in Redwood City, California, is a leading global interactive entertainment software company. Founded in 1982, the Company develops, publishes, and distributes interactive software worldwide for video game systems, personal computers, wireless devices and the Internet. Electronic Arts markets its products under four brand names: EATM, EA SPORTSTM, EA MobileTM and POGOTM. In fiscal 2009, EA posted GAAP net revenue of $4.2 billion and had 31 titles that sold more than one million copies. EA’s homepage and online game site is www.ea.com.
